• (03) After full consideration of the budget, the Commissioners of the <br /> Authority shall approve it and the Chair of the Authority shall submit the <br /> budget to the City Council not later than the tenth day of September of <br /> each year. <br /> ARTICLE 6. <br /> SCOPE OF POWERS AND DUTIES <br /> 6.1) Contracts and Procurement <br /> (01) All construction work and work of demolition and clearing, <br /> contracts for services or for repairs, maintenance and replacements, and <br /> every purchase of equipment, supplies or materials and contracts therefor <br /> shall be in accordance with the procurement policies, if any, established <br /> by resolution of the Authority. <br /> (02) Approval of Contract by Attorney - Except for the purchase of <br /> expendable office supplies, no contract shall be made by the Authority <br /> through any officer or employee except in writing approved as to form by <br /> the attorney for the Authority. <br /> (03) Execution of Contracts - Unless otherwise directed by the <br /> Authority or required by the State or Federal agencies furnishing funds to <br /> the Authority, all contracts shall be executed on behalf of the Authority <br /> by any two of the officers of the Authority, or one officer of the Authority <br /> and the Executive Director. <br /> 6.3) Disbursements <br /> (01) Federal Funds - All funds received from the Government of the <br /> United States or any of its agencies shall be disbursed and accounted for <br /> in accordance with the regulations or requirements from time to time <br /> made by the Federal agencies furnishing said funds to the Authority. <br /> (02) Official Depository - All monies received by the Authority from any <br /> source whatsoever shall be deposited in approved bank accounts of the <br /> Authority and shall be disbursed only by check, except that petty cash <br /> funds not exceeding One Hundred Dollars ($100) at any time may be <br /> maintained by the Authority. <br /> (03) Checks - All checks drawn on bank accounts of the Authority shall <br /> indicate the fund and, in the case of a project, the project to be charged. <br /> • All checks shall be signed by the two designated Commissioners of the <br /> Authority, or one officer of the Authority and the Executive Director. <br /> 5 <br />
